c# api身份验证和授权

  

1. 全局验证

 config.Filters.Add(new AuthorizeAttribute());

2.控制器级别的验证

   
  [Authorize]   
public class HelloController : ApiController { public string GetTest() { return "hello,world"; } }

3.方法级别的验证

    public class HelloController : ApiController
    {
        [Authorize]
        public string GetTest()
        {
            return "hello,world";
        }

    }

访问会得到 

http://localhost:55658/api/hello 

扫描二维码关注公众号,回复: 6820057 查看本文章

猜你喜欢

转载自www.cnblogs.com/buchizaodian/p/11209540.html
今日推荐